Jungle_vip Posted April 10, 2021 Share Posted April 10, 2021 It’s a carnation coral, strawberry coral, or the actual name of dendronepthya. Very beautiful coral. It is an expert level specimen. If you don’t have much experience I would recommend staying away. They have perished in many aquariums. Do some research on their care requirements if you just have to have it but more than likely it will be difficult or impossible for a beginner or novice aquarist. Quote Link to comment

MrP Posted April 10, 2021 Share Posted April 10, 2021 This is a Scleronephthya which is similar to a Dendronepthya. Although they are said to be a bit easier to keep than a Dendronepthya, they are still considered an expert only coral. Quote Link to comment
